How does the Base Game actually pay?

The base game is the waiting room. You are spinning a classic 3×3 grid, aiming to line up three matching symbols across one of the 5 paylines. The payouts are decent for a 3-reeler, but they are clearly designed to keep your balance alive while you hunt for the bonus.

The Symbol Hierarchy and Payouts

Understanding the math here is crucial. Based on a 2.00 total bet, the paytable breaks down as follows:

  • Red Sevens: The top tier symbol, paying 80.00 (40x your stake). This mirrors the high-value symbol structures found in other classic 3-reelers like Wild Fruits 27.
  • Watermelons: Drops significantly to 16.00 (8x your stake).
  • Grapes: Pays 8.00 (4x your stake).
  • Low Fruits: Plums, Oranges, Lemons, and Cherries pay between 8.00 and 2.00 (4x to 1x).

It is a steep drop-off. The Red Seven is the only symbol that generates a “big win” feeling in the base game. The rest are essentially bankroll sustainers, much like the low-paying candies in Sweet Bonanza.

The 999x Mechanic: How does the Bonus Game work?

This is why you are here. The entire purpose of Joker X Love revolves around landing three Joker Scatter symbols. When this happens, the base game disappears, and a unique pop-up row appears on the screen.

Decoding the “Digit Construction” vs. Summation

Most slots sum up multipliers (e.g., 5x + 10x = 15x). Joker X Love does something different, remarkably similar to the mechanic seen in Money Coming by TaDa Gaming or its sequel, Money Coming 2 – Expanded Bets. The three reels spin to reveal digits from 0 to 9. They don't add up; they form a number.

If you reveal a ‘1' on the left, a ‘9' in the middle, and a ‘6' on the right, your prize isn't 16x. It is 196x your total bet.

This positional value system creates massive variance. A ‘9' on the right reel is worth 9x. A ‘9' on the left reel guarantees at least 900x. The tension lies entirely in that leftmost reel. The range is technically 5x to 999x, meaning the difference between a flop and a jackpot is literally a matter of pixel placement. It creates the same instant-win tension found in Money Coming.

Mathematical Paradox of the Slot

Here is where the math gets tricky for the player. The paradox of the digit reveal mechanic is that while the visual representation suggests an equal chance for any number from 005 to 999, the RNG weighting is almost certainly skewed heavily towards lower digits in the high-value positions (hundreds column).

Players often assume that getting a “9” in the first column is just as likely as getting it in the last column. However, in variable-pay mechanics like this, the probability of locking a high integer in the “Hundreds” reel is exponentially lower than locking it in the “Units” reel. You aren't fighting one layer of RNG; you are fighting a positional weighting system. This means that while the potential is 999x, the median outcome of the bonus round is likely closer to the 15x-35x range, creating a “illusion of proximity” to the max win that keeps you spinning.

How does the Bonus Round work?

Three Joker Scatters trigger a pop-up reel that reveals three digits to construct a multiplier from 5x to 999x.

Is Joker X Love high volatility?

Yes, due to the digit-construction mechanic, the variance is high with significant gaps between minimum and maximum payouts.
